Creating Custom Reports

For most reports, the controls in the report menu are divided into four sections:

1. Report Selection: controls the type of report that will be generated, see

5.3.4 Report

Selection

on page 5.17.

2. Time Selection: controls the time or range of time for which the report is generated,

see

5.3.5 Time Selection

on page 5.31.

3. Object Selection: controls the specific objects to be included in the report, see

5.3.6

Object Selection

on page 5.33.

4. Format Selection (web client only): controls the format of the report, see

5.3.7

Format Selection (Web interface only)

on page 5.45.

Use the controls in the menu to select the desired report parameters and then click Generate

Report. See

Figure 5-4

for a listing of the controls that are available for each report and then

consult the relevant sections later in this chapter for complete details.

NOTE: The Summary report does not include the Object selection, but provides

options for selecting columns instead; see

Select Summary Columns

on page 5.24

NOTE: The Excel client does not include a Format Selection but instead allows you

to choose and modify the charts and graphs after the report is generated. See

5.4

Working with Excel Charts

on page 5.52 for details.

NOTE: Adaptive Optimization reports have different options for the report

selection and do not include the object selection section. For details on Adaptive

Optimization reports, see

Chapter 9, Using Adaptive Optimization

.

CAUTION: Filtering large numbers of objects may exceed the limit for your server,

in which case you should reduce the number of objects being filtered and try

again.
